Pepe Wallet address
Pda8Eu1XLCGSKDgf4GQk398nrqc8No6eRZ
Transactions
7
Total PEPE Received
1,999,619.90905346
Total PEPE Sent
69,950.00
PEPE Balance
1,929,669.90905346